SOURCE: Only one of the wash cycles on my Maytag Neptune
Is it a FAV6800AW or FAV9800AW machine? Sounds like it is. I believe you have a Control Board issue; the Control Board has a 5yr warranty. Do you want to DIY a fix or call in a Appliance Repair Tech? Have you reset the 120VAC power on the machine? If not give the Control Board a hard reset by pulling the washer power plug for 10 seconds or so and then re-power up the machine.
I’ll attach the Service Manual link located on this site for reference. See if you can get into Service Mode, try this.
To enter Service Mode, this from the SM.
Enter / Exit Service Mode
To enter Service Mode press the Enviro Plus and Spin Only keys simultaneously for three seconds or until the control beeps. The Console display will show “00”.
Access Board Output Test by pressing the Delicates key. The console display will show “ot”
The lid lock will lock and the Quick Wash LED will be lit. Will the machine allow you into Service Mode? If not then it’s time to replace the Control Board. Press the Off button to back out of Service Mode.

SOURCE: whirlpool washing machine...only uses hot water
Make sure the hoses are connected correctly to the water valve on the machine. The connections will be marked with an "H" and a "C".
Given they are correct, most current washing machines have and auto temp feature on the water fill. It allows even cold water settings to bring in some hot water to make sure the water temp is hot enough to efficiently disolve your laundry detergant. The preset temps are usually around 75* for cold, and 105* for warm. Hot water comes in at whatever temp your household water temp is.
